Wonder if this could be the family in 1881 indexed under Fareday but clearly Fereday on image - birthplace Great Bridge is a couple of miles from Dudley
1881 RG11/2807 fol.100 p.5/6
No 37 Boats On Canal, Wolverhampton, Staffordshire
FEREDAY
Thomas head M 35 Boatman Oldbury, Staffordshire
Emma wife M 29 Wolverhampton "
William son 9 " "
Thomas son 5 Great Bridge "
Lavina dau 2 Northampton Northamptonshire
Thomas son 5 m Wolverhampton Staffordshire
odd to have 2 sons named Thomas but that's what it says! Perhaps a stepson?
If father Thomas was a boatman that could be why I'm struggling to find them in other census
Barbara
-
Thomas Fereday married Emma Faulkes Dec Qu 1874 Daventry 3b 189 so that son William must be from a previous marriage?
